Carpentry Programs, Courses and Degrees in Yukon

  • Women Exploring Trades & Technology - Yukon College
    Yukon College's 16-week Women Exploring Trades and Technology program provides students with an introduction to a variety of trades, including Carpentry, Electrical, General Mechanics, Pipe Trades, and Welding as well as a broad array of skills. The Program will enable participants 'to make informed decisions as to the potential and suitability of a career in Trades and Technology.' Graduates of the Program may pursue employment in numerous trades as well as apprenticeship training.

  • Carpentry Apprentice Level III - Yukon College
    An apprenticeship is a method of learning a trade through a combination of periods of in-class, technical/theoretical education and periods of paid, on-the-job training. In Yukon, completing a carpentry apprenticeship normally takes about 4 years, in-class and on-the-job training combined. The in-class portion of an apprenticeship will be delivered via 4 eight-week sessions per year, and Yukon College's Carpentry Apprentice Training Level III fulfills the requirements for the third of these 8-week sessions.

  • Carpentry Pre-Employment - Yukon College
    Yukon College's 20-week Carpentry Pre-Employment program prepares students to pursue a career, career advancement, or further educational opportunities in the carpentry profession or related fields. The Program provides students with 'a good knowledge base for an entry-level position in the job force' as well as 'completion of the theoretical requirements for Level 1 of the Carpentry Apprenticeship program.'
